Explanation

RNA interference (RNAi) is a biological process in which RNA molecules inhibit gene expression or translation, by neutralizing targeted mRNA molecules. It has gained popularity due to its potential in various fields: 1. It is used in developing gene silencing therapies. This is a core application of RNAi. By targeting specific messenger RNA (mRNA) molecules, RNAi can 'silence' or turn off the expression of particular genes. This has significant therapeutic potential for diseases caused by overexpressed or abnormal genes. 2. It can be used in developing therapies for the treatment of cancer. Many cancers are driven by the overexpression of certain genes or abnormal gene activity. RNAi can be used to silence these oncogenes or genes critical for cancer cell survival and proliferation, making it a promising area for cancer therapy development. 3. It can be used to develop hormone replacement therapies. This statement is incorrect. Hormone replacement therapy (HRT) involves administering hormones (e.g., estrogen, progesterone, testosterone) to replenish deficient levels in the body. RNAi is a gene silencing mechanism and is not directly used for hormone replacement; it affects gene expression, not the direct supply of hormones. 4. It can be used to produce crop plants that are resistant to viral pathogens. This statement is correct. RNAi can be engineered into plants to target specific viral RNA sequences, thereby interfering with the viral replication cycle and making the plants resistant to viral infections. This is a significant application in agricultural biotechnology. Therefore, statements 1, 2, and 4 are correct.
